37-year-old man charged in connection with December murder in Carrère

A 37-year-old suspect has been charged as part of an investigation into a murder that occurred in December in the Carrère neighbourhood of Martinique. The facts date back to the end of last year, when a person was killed in this area of the island.

An investigation conducted by criminal investigation police services made it possible to identify a man as a potential perpetrator of this crime. After being questioned by investigators, he was presented to the public prosecutor before being referred to an investigating judge. The magistrate decided to charge him with voluntary homicide.

The suspect was also placed in remand custody pending further proceedings. The investigation is continuing in order to determine precisely the circumstances in which this death occurred and to establish all responsibilities.

This case is part of the context of the fight against violent crime being carried out by judicial authorities and law enforcement in Martinique. Several homicide cases have dominated local news in recent months, mobilising the investigative resources of the Fort-de-France public prosecutor's office.
